"Building upon that research, and perhaps adding an extra layer of complexity, a
new study out of Nottingham Trent has found that 54 percent of all males and 68
percent of all females ""gender swap""--or create online personas of their
opposite sex. The study found that males and females had different reasons for
gender swapping, with female gamers primarily seeking to avoid ""unsolicited
male approaches"" and male swappers finding that they are treated far better by
other males. In the words of one male participant quoted in the study, ""Nerd +
Boob = Loot."" Titled ""Gender Swapping and Socializing in Cyberspace: An
Exploratory Study,"" the study was conducted by Zaheer Hussain and Mark
Griffiths and surveyed 115 participants, 83 of which were male and 32 female.
The survey was conducted through various MMOG-enthusiast forums, and the
researchers noted that flaws to the study may include the relatively small
sample size and the self-reporting format. ""What makes these findings important
is that in most instances, the gamer has the opportunity to choose the gender of
his or her character and to develop other aspects of the character before
beginning to play,"" concluded the researchers. ""Choosing to gender swap may
have an effect on the gamer's style of play and interaction with other gamers
and could even have an effect on guild membership."" Researchers also noted that
the study supported previous findings that ""suggest the female persona has a
number of positive social attributes in a male-oriented environment."" Yep, this

"For most developers, hosting a convention dedicated solely to the company's
wares would be considered audacious at best. Of course, when that developer is
Blizzard Entertainment, and every game touched turns to gold--irrespective of
how long that alchemical process takes--one massive event per region is hardly
enough. With BlizzCon and the Blizzard Worldwide Invitational occupying North
America and Asian markets respectively last year, the Irvine, California-based
superdeveloper is pitching camp in Europe for the 2008 Blizzard Entertainment
Worldwide Invitational convention and tournament. The first-of-its-kind Blizzard
event for Europe is slated to run June 28-29 at the Porte de Versailles
Exposition Centre in Paris, France. Tickets are priced at €70 (about $110), and
go on sale Thursday, March 20 on the developer's official Web site for the
event. In addition to invite-only tournaments in which professional gamers will
vie for $100,000, the 2008 Blizzard Worldwide Invitational will host a number of
casual tournaments, cosplay contests, live musical performances, and developer
meet and greets. Attendees will also receive a swag bag that contains an
exclusive WOW in-game pet as well as ""a beta key for an upcoming Blizzard
Entertainment game."" At last year's events, Blizzard's devout were first
enraptured by the long-awaited reveal of Starcraft II in Seoul and then sent
into a bona fide tizzy on the debut of World of Warcraft's next expansion--Wrath
of the Lich King--in Anaheim. This year, speculation is rife over whether
Blizzard will use the event to unveil its new, original massively multiplayer
online game. There's also speculation, fueled by several job postings on the
developer's Web site, that the next installment in the infernal Diablo franchise
could debut. In a study conducted by Jane Barnett and colleagues at Middlesex
University, psychologists found that gamers were more likely to be calm or
simply tired after playing, rather than itching to go outside and kick someone's
head in.


The researchers surveyed 292 male and female online gamers aged between 12 and
83 and had them play the massively multiplayer online role-playing game World of
Warcraft. They were asked to complete a survey about anger, aggression, and
personality prior to and following a two-hour session of WOW, which is only
rated T for Teen in the US and 12+ in the UK. Mostly, the researchers found that
people were more tranquil after a good bout of Azerothian bloodletting. ""There
were actually higher levels of relaxation before and after playing the game, as
opposed to experiencing anger,"" Barnett said in a statement before adding the
caveat, ""This did very much depend on personality " "In February, game industry

"ANAHEIM, Calif.--Following two very public leaks in Germany and the US,
Blizzard Entertainment surprised virtually no one today when it announced the
second expansion to its wildly popular massively multiplayer online role-playing
game, World of Warcraft. Titled the Wrath of the Lich King, the expansion will
add a passel of new content to the game, which now boasts a staggering 9 million
players worldwide. The announcement was made by Blizzard's Frank Pierce this
morning at BlizzCon, the Vivendi Games-owned publisher's annual fan event.
First, he briefly talked about some content updates that introduce guild banks
and integrated voice chat via live content updates. Then he discussed Zuluman, a
new 10-person instance in the Ghost Lands featuring Forest Trolls battling
against Blood Elves. He looks like an understanding fellow... Then, after coyly
mentioning that Blizzard's ""dev team has been working on bigger things,""
Pierce officially unveiled Wrath of the Lich King. The expansion will open up
the continent of Northrend--first seen in Warcraft III--to WOW players for the
first time. The expansion's storyline will center on the lich king Arthas
Menethil, who was prominently featured in the expansion Warcraft III: The Frozen
Throne. Arthas has ""merged with the spirit"" of another lich king, Ner'zhul,
the former orc shaman and Undead Scourge leader introduced in Warcraft II: The
Tides of Darkness. Now, the joined ghostly monarchs have ""set things in motion
that could threaten all life in Azeroth,"" according to Pierce. Apparently,
players will be introduced to the story as soon as they set foot into Northrend.
BlizzCon venue, the Anaheim Convention Center. Wrath of the Lich King will raise
the level cap in WOW to 80 and will add new abilities and talents to all
classes. It will also introduce the Death Knight hero class and a new
profession--inscription--that will let players permanently enhance spells and
abilities.


The expansion will also add new character-customization options, such as

convention center lights came up. " "Today, Activision and Vivendi Games cleared
yet one more hurdle lying in the path of their $18.9 billion merger. The
European Commission, which is part of the European Union, has approved the deal
under its antitrust guidelines, concluding that an Activision Vivendi mash-up
""would not significantly impede effective competition in the European Economic
Area or any substantial part of it."" According to the EC's report, the merger's
reach was measured on both a horizontal and vertical scale.
